Bug#238862: gnome-panel: windowlist applet does not group correctly
reopen 238862 thanks Christian Marillat schrieb: >>Package: gnome-panel >>Version: 2.4.2-3 >>Severity: normal >> >> >>The old windowlist applet from woody could group window entries from >>the same application, like all the emacsen or all xterms. The new >>version is only able to group windows like mozilla. xterms and emacsen >>are all displayed separately in the applet. Now if I have a lot of >>xterms open the applet is really crowded. > Simply now this applet in compliant whith HIG : > > http://developer.gnome.org/projects/gup/hig/ > > FYI I'll close all bugs related to hig This is a bug and not a feature request. Fixing this does not violate the HIG. Please don't just close this bugreport. Bug#239730: /etc/init.d/hylafax: start just once
Package: hylafax-server Version: 1:4.1.8-2 Severity: minor File: /etc/init.d/hylafax Just noting that in /etc/default/hylafax # Uncomment this line once hylafax has been fully configured and/or # you want to disable the server. # #RUN_HYLAFAX=1 1. s/disable/enable/ 2. for those of us who leave it commented, there is no # invoke-rc.d hylafax option that will start the server just once, without us needing to edit /etc/default/hylafax
